London Jazz News With Andy Davies (trumpet), Alex Webb (piano), Andrew Cleyndert (bass) and Alfonso Vitale (drums) the group traces the explosive music of American saxophonist Julian 'Cannnonball' Adderley from his first session as leader in 1955 through work with Miles Davis to the soul-jazz of the 1960s. The repertoire includes Adderley brothers classics like 'Things Are Getting Better', 'Work Song', 'Del Sasser', 'Sack o'Woe' and many others.   • The Bernstein/Stewart/ Goldings Organ Trio have been called “one of current jazz’s finest small groups” by JazzTimes magazine and “the longest-lived and most virtuosic organ trio in existence” by SFJazz. Together now for thirty years, they’ve recorded over a dozen albums and performed hundreds of concerts in festivals around the world. Their grooving repertoire celebrates the influence including Larry Young, Jimmy Smith and Jack McDuff. This trio stands out due to their brilliant musicianship, their ability to play difficult music and have it sound easy, and their commitment to groove no matter what tempo or style.
